A walk through your First Years Cake Smash Session:

A cake smash, its a modern photoshoot that encourages sensory play whilst capturing an age that like to be on the move and learning day by day.

For most parents this is a new concept and it can be a difficult concept for you to understand as there are so many choices. 

Here at Annabelle Smith Photography I like to make everything easy to understand along with helping you to create the artwork you desire.

When booking your session you receive digital leaflets- one containing a variety of backdrops all number listed so you can tell me the exact number you like. Another digital leaflet with outfits again listed with numbers for you to select or you can bring your own.

You also receive an image with different cakes and information on how to choose the perfect cake for your little one, I will always recommend that your child has tried cake and you prepare them for their session rather than turning up and them learning a new food during a photoshoot.

Here is my recommendations on cakes:

-The Naked cake- not too messy and perfect for exploring. 

-The iced drip cake- perfect for babies with delicate hands who like to stay clean, they can play with all aspects of the cake the drip, the white icing and small layers of the frosting without getting messy hands.

-The giant cupcake- for those babies who love messy play- be prepared for us all to get messy.

-The combination drip and naked cake- not too messy and perfect for exploring the drip adds another layer of fun.

-The blended ombre cake- not too messy and perfect for exploring.

During your session:

When you arrive for your session the studio is through the side gate and will take place in the log cabin at the back of the property. I will greet you at the gate and show you to the studio, please park fully on the parking space out the front or on the driveway.

We will firstly get your little one familiar with the environment then get your baby changed if he/she isn’t already in their cake smash outfit. 

Firstly they can play with yourself in the swing and together we capture some gorgeous smiling photographs with natural smilies and in doing so we get them used to the environment.

Secondly start with the non messy photographs with the ‘1’ and ‘ONE’ props capturing some timeless artwork before the messy play begins. 

After 10-20 minutes I will bring their cake over and we can watch how your little one explores their cake. 

Each baby is different some like to have a look around the cake first, some take small pieces and enjoy the taste, some like to use the spoon to tap the cake and others like to use their mouth to take some yummy bites. Please do not worry about how your child responds to the cake every baby is different and no matter what I will always capture some beautiful milestone photographs.

after spending 20-30 minutes with the cake (sometimes less each child is different) I will clean up the area ready for splash time.

Splash time is a fantastic way to capture your little one splashing and smiling for the camera- most babies at this age enjoy a bath and this is a perfect way to create some bath images that parents love to look back on. This lasts for 5 minutes then you have time to finish cleaning them up and getting them ready to go home.

3. Some little ones need help understanding their cake.
You have booked them in for an exciting cake smash! You expect them to dive in and throw it everywhere! This is the case for most little ones however, if they have never eaten cake before this is a new experience and sometimes they need us to give them a helping hand. No mater what I am able to capture there experience and get some cute images of them inspecting the cake and delicately taking the cake apart. A favourite song or toy always helps if your little one is shy.
